JCC Website of the Month: Selection Process

Dear Colleagues,
We continue to get requests each month from JCCs nominating their websites to be Site of the Month. We are aware of all the great changes you’ve been making to your websites, and the selection process is more and more competitive. However, to become site of the month you need to meet our criteria.

We review each site's performance in a variety of categories and give it a numerical value in each area. These areas include:

Brand
Use of the JCC Movement brand includes the following components:
• Fonts
• Colors
• Silhouetted images
• Brand badge
• Illustrations
• Brand Voice
• Overall Look and Feel

Currentness of content
• Event information not older then current month
• Extra points for weekly or daily info updates

Registration
• Contact information with each event or class
• Ability to register online for classes or events
• Extra points for ability to join the JCC online

Online Donations
• Contact info on a donate page (it’s important for your users to be able to find out who can help them)
• Downloadable PDF contribution forms
• Online giving through a secure site

Contact information
• Full contact information (phone number and address) of the JCC at the bottom of every page
• Staff contact page with phone numbers or extensions and e-mails of the staff

Information about Israel
As a Jewish organization we feel that our connection with Israel should be prominent. We believe that JCCs should be promoting Israel through programming and web.

Links to Jewish Organizations
JCCs play a big part in Jewish communities, and for that reason we feel JCCs should display links to local Jewish organizations on their pages. A links page would be most useful as an informational tool for new community members.
• At the very least, there should be a link to the federation, JCC Association, and United Way (if your JCC receives funding from them).
• Local Jewish organizational links
• Extra points for a full Jewish resources page

Usability
Your users should be able to navigate easily through the site to find and do the following things:
• Programming information (events and other programming)
• Transactions (donations, registrations, etc.)
• Operational information (hours of operation, location, directions, etc.)

Technical
• The site should load quickly, under 10 seconds.

Design
• Visually appealing
• Easy to read
• No obvious distractions
• Balance of graphics and text
• Font, size and color suitable for online reading

Nuts and Bolts
• Privacy policy
• Security statement
• Terms of use
• Figure out a way to collect e-mail addresses from your members – offer an incentive, newsletter, etc.

Navigation
• Consistent menu structure (same links in same place on every page)
• Functional search option that works, or a site map
